Why lab data matters for THCA products
In markets where THCA products are available, lab data becomes essential for verifying cannabinoid content and safety. Reputable producers publish certificates of analysis showing potency, contaminants, and terpenes. Consumers benefit from a clear understanding of how much THCA is present in a gummy and what that translates to in effects. While not every product carries the same profile, consistency across batches is a strong signal of quality and trustworthiness for responsible buyers.
